As she woke again she felt cold metal restraining her. Fastening her hooves to the ground, her back to the wall, her wings where pressed apart and her jaw clamped firmly shut. She was also blindfolded. This was what she saw every day, but she heard different, each day they would send in someone to feed her, a different one each time. Sometimes they would try talking to her, making her feel better or convincing her to escape. She never talked during the meal times. She was never allowed to see light, or others or even use a bathroom. She was to live the rest of her life here, or until they said otherwise. She knew that she was meant to die here, but she also knew that she would have to be granted a trial before the full sentence.
I was trained for death, not life. Everything about me revolves around that one state, Death; even now it comes for several others and me. She thought. She had long since made a plan to escape, but it was a silly children’s dream. There was no escape, not unless her sisters and brothers came for her, but she knew that they wouldn’t. She knew the code as well as the next. Don’t try to rescue captives. And now she saw why, clear as day. She had screwed up, and was now paying for it with her life. As she continued to drift in thought, the door opened, no noise was made as the stranger walked across the room. Only when they stood directly in front of her did she realize that they where there. Not from breath, nor shuffle, but a feeling of proximity and personal space. They stood there for what seemed like a lifetime, but in all reality was only a few milliseconds.
“Really fucked up now didn’t you? Jeez, you know the amount of paperwork that had to be done to cover our sorry hides? You knew that this mission was fruitless but noooo, you had to get the money for your precious animal shelter! Well now those animals are living on there own, even that bunny of yours, what’s its name again? Whatever, she is dead now, eaten by griffins. Damn it! Why couldn’t you listen to us?! You were like a true sister to me! You where the only family I had left!” she stayed silent for two reasons. One; because she was too shocked that he was here, now. Two because she still had the steel locking mask on her jaw.
“I want to hear you answer me,” he said angrily as he pulled out the keys to her mask. He proceeded to unlock and pull off her locking mask. He left the blindfold on, luckily.
“I-I-I don’t know why I took the job” her voice was hoarse, due to not having spoken in so long, “I d-didn’t think—“
“That’s it then. You didn’t think. I should have known. You value those dumb animals more than your own kind. Damn it, damn it all.”
She couldn’t help it, she was a merciless killer, but she still had feelings especially for animals. And it was worse when she realized that he wasn’t getting her out of here. She began to cry, like how she had most of her childhood.
“Don’t think that will work on me. I know all your tricks, and even a few of the ones you didn’t even know you used.” That made her cry harder. “Look, when you go to trial, you have to plead guilty, or your sentence will be much more harsh, if you convince Luna to spare and save you for a time of war, well... you know the rest of that story..”
She finally stopped sobbing long enough to comprehend what was being told to her. “So i-i-if-f I c-can convince her t-that m-my life has-s value, I will l-live?” she needed this confirmed.
“Yes, you will live, under constant watch, but still…”
She simply smiled, her blindfold soaked with tears, she asks him to leave, and to find her a lawyer. With the happy thoughts flowing she remembered when she joined the Creed.
